/**
* Class that monitors for a certain class of Jetty bug known to
* affect TaskTrackers. In this type of bug, the Jetty selector
* thread starts spinning and using ~100% CPU while no actual
* HTTP content is being served. Given that this bug has been
* active in Jetty/JDK for a long time with no resolution in site,
* this class provides a temporary workaround.
*
* Upon detecting the selector thread spinning, it simply exits the
* JVM with a Fatal message.
*/
